Jul 14, 1961 Feb 05, 2021 Julie Ann Mills, age 59, of San Angelo TX, the daughter of Pat and Joel “Joe” Mills went to be with the Lord on Friday, February 5, 2021. Julie was a proud graduate of Texas Tech University. After working at the Federal Reserve Bank of Dallas for over 17 years, Julie relocated in 2001 to Mesa, Arizona to join her mother and step-father where she established her company Palaju, Inc. (Retail Services) where they operated a successful business. The name “Palaju” was derived from the first two letters of Pat, Larry and Julie. The ‘trio’ worked and played together. After the death of her mother and step-father, Julie returned home to San Angelo in 2017 where she joined the family of 1st Community Federal Credit Union as a Business Loan Officer. ....
The Rev. Keith Mills died at home on Monday, Feb. 1. He was 65. 5:33 pm, Feb. 2, 2021 × The Rev. Keith Mills died at home on Monday, Feb. 1. He was 65. Contributed photo The Rev. Keith Mills, the Conference Minister of the United Church of Christ Northern Plains Conference, died of a heart attack at his home in Streeter, N.D., on Monday, Feb. 1, his church announced Tuesday. He was 65. Mills leaves behind his wife, Denise Mills, and three adult children. According to a press release, celebration of life arrangements has not yet been finalized. The Rev. Dr. Kevin Cassiday-Maloney, of First Congregational UCC of Fargo, described Mills as a person who lived what he preached, and what he preached was having love for everyone. ....
